Calgary is 13 hours behind Jakarta, which is far enough that a normal 9-to-5 in one city never reaches the other's working hours. One practical option: Calgary dials in early while it's still late afternoon or evening in Jakarta. These times hold for most of the year, but Calgary's daylight saving (which Jakarta doesn't use) shifts them by an hour twice annually.
